HEALTH AND SAFETY CODE 25180.7 <br /> (b) Any designated government employee who obtains information in the course of his official duties revealing the <br /> illegal discharge or threatened illegal discharge of a hazardous waste within the geographical area of his <br /> jurisdiction and who knows that such discharge or threatened discharge is likely to cause substantial injury to <br /> the public health or safety must, within seventy-two hours, disclose such information to the local Board of <br /> Supervisors and to the local health officer. No disclosure if information is required under this subdivision <br /> when otherwise prohibited by law, or when law enforcement personnel have determined that such disclosure <br /> would adversely affect an ongoing criminal investigation, or when the information is already general public <br /> knowledge within the locality affected by the discharge or threatened discharge. <br /> (c) Any designated government employee who knowingly and intentionally fails to disclose information required <br /> to be disclosed under subdivision (b) shall, upon conviction, be punished by imprisonment in the county jail <br /> for not more than one year or by imprisonment in state prison for not more than three years. The court may <br /> also impose upon the person a fine of not less than five thousand.dollars ($5000) or more than twenty-five <br /> thousand dollars ($25,000). The felony conviction for violation of this section shall require forfeiture of <br /> government employment within thirty days of conviction. <br /> I.
